Category guide
2'-O-MOE Nucleosides products serve as starting materials, protected intermediates and analytical comparators in nucleoside, nucleotide and oligonucleotide chemistry.
Confirm anomeric and sugar stereochemistry, base identity, substitution position, protecting-group pattern and required downstream transformation.
Use orthogonal identity data such as NMR and MS together with chromatographic purity, water or residual-solvent review and route-specific impurity controls.
Product-family considerations
- Nucleoside catalogs provide flexible entry points for protecting-group, phosphorylation and glycosylation-route development.
- Availability of related analogs helps researchers compare base, sugar and substitution effects systematically.
- Downstream use often requires additional protection, activation or purification before incorporation into oligonucleotide workflows.
- Isomeric purity, water content and residual solvents should be matched to the planned chemistry.
